Tanzania quake toll: 14 dead, 200 hurt

Dar Es Salaam: A 5.7-magnitude earthquake that struck Tanzania, close to Lake Victoria and the border with Uganda, has killed at least 14 people and injured 200, local authorities said yesterday.
A group of 15 boys, who were secondary-school boarders in the worst-hit city of Bukoba, were believed to be among the casualties. Prime Minister Kassim Majaliwa joined mourners at the Bukoba stadium later yesterday.
